Big O & Tranzformer – High Creative State Of Mind EP (Album Review)

Big O and Tranzformer cook up seven high-quality instrumentals in “High Creative State Of Mind EP.”

TOP 3

3. Life’s Delight

Do you know something that is very underrated? When a song sounds like what its title is.

“Life’s Delight” can be considered one of Big O and Tranzformer’s most therapeutic creations. The instrumental features delightful piano notes, a steady tempo, and a blend of old-school hip-hop, atmospheric, and gentle vibes. Pressing play on this track is an instant mood booster.

Pairing the experience of enjoying a Chinese delight dish with the soothing sounds of “Life’s Delight” is likely the pinnacle of satisfaction.

2. Everyday (Remix) (Ft. Fashawn, Cashius King & Spray Money)

I just had to put the one track with raps on this list.

Do you know the only thing better than a high-quality beat that’s easy on the ears? A high-quality beat with great rap verses. In “Everyday (Remix),” we get just that. Over the smooth, therapeutic backdrop that Big O and Tranzformer provide, Fashawn, Cashius King, and Spray Money deliver excellent verses. They are laid down with great ease, boast wise and competitive lyrics, and feature some really good punchlines. This track reminds me that nothing beats a rap track with good chemistry, a smooth beat, and rappers who don’t have to do a bunch of gimmicks to get their s**t off.

1. Flashy girls

I love soul and being high off life, so “Flashy girls” resonated with me mightily.

“Flashy Girls” is the perfect tune to play on a rainy day when you’re seeking nothing but pleasant vibes. Rooted in soulfulness and gentleness, it also carries an excellent knock that infuses the song with positive energy.

Honey Brown’s contributions to “Flashy girls” is small but impactful. She channels the R&B vocals of damn-there every single popular black singer that your grandparents love to tell you “was before your time.” It’s both refreshing and reflective to listen to.

OVERALL RATING

(B)


If you haven’t experienced an instrumental album by Big O yet, you’re definitely missing out. His creations are of high quality, multi-layered, and diverse. In this collaboration with Tranzformer, another producer known for great work, we are treated to seven exceptional instrumentals.

One aspect of this project that I appreciate is its therapeutic sound. The instrumentals blend hip-hop vibes with soothing elements, providing a massage-like experience for the ears. The atmospheric elements add to the overall feel-good ambiance. Despite its brevity, this project succeeds in rekindling my love for pure music.
